Law firm with ties to Trump administration declines offer to represent migrant children

A small law firm with ties to the Trump administration declined a $150 million contract to represent migrant children, while another group received work worth up to $244 million to advocate for them. These events occur amid questions about who will represent unaccompanied migrant children in court due to plans for mass deportations. The federal Office of Refugee Resettlement oversaw the contracts and awarded the larger sum to Our Rescue.
